C.I.T. FINANCIAL SERVICES, INC. v. McDERMITT

No. 47954.

544 P.2d 913 (1975)

C.I.T. FINANCIAL SERVICES, INC., Appellee, v. Opal Eunice McDERMITT, Appellant, and Connecticut General Life Insurance Company, a corporation, Appellee.

Court of Appeals of Oklahoma, Division No. 1.

Released for Publication December 31, 1975.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

John P. Scott and Robert W. Raynolds, Tulsa, for appellant.

Boesche, McDermott & Eskridge by Glenn R. Davis, Tulsa, for appellee Connecticut General Life Ins. Co.


Released for Publication by Order of Court of Appeals December 31, 1975.

REYNOLDS, Judge:

This appeal involves a cross-petition against credit accident and sickness insuror to obtain payment of a note pursuant to policy provisions.
